|
Stock Options Outstanding (Detail) (USD $)
|12 Months Ended
|
|
|
Oct. 31, 2014
|
Oct. 25, 2013
|
Oct. 26, 2012
|Share Based Compensation Shares Authorized Under Stock Option Plans Exercise Price Range [Line Items]
|
|
|
|Options Exercisable, Shares
|754,443us-gaap_ShareBasedCompensationArrangementByShareBasedPaymentAwardOptionsExercisableNumber
|1,075,788us-gaap_ShareBasedCompensationArrangementByShareBasedPaymentAwardOptionsExercisableNumber
|1,258,900us-gaap_ShareBasedCompensationArrangementByShareBasedPaymentAwardOptionsExercisableNumber
|$29.86 - $40.00
|
|
|
|Share Based Compensation Shares Authorized Under Stock Option Plans Exercise Price Range [Line Items]
|
|
|
|Range of Exercise Prices, lower limit
|$ 29.86us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eLowerRangeLimit
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= esl_RangeOneMember
|
|
|Range of Exercise Prices, upper limit
|$ 40.00us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eUpperRangeLimit
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= esl_RangeOneMember
|
|
|Options Outstanding, Shares
|118,093us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eNumberOfOutstandingOptions
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= esl_RangeOneMember
|
|
|Options Outstanding Weighted Average Remaining Life (years)
|3 years 4 months 24 days
|
|
|Options Outstanding, Weighted Average Price
|$ 33.82us-gaap_Sharebas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eOutstandingOptionsWeightedAverageExercisePriceBeginningBalance1
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= esl_RangeOneMember
|
|
|Options Exercisable, Shares
|118,093us-gaap_ShareBasedCompensationArrangementByShareBasedPaymentAwardOptionsExercisableNumber
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= esl_RangeOneMember
|
|
|Options Exercisable, Weighted Average Price
|$ 33.82us-gaap_Sharebas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eExercisableOptionsWeightedAverageExercisePrice1
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= esl_RangeOneMember
|
|
|$40.01 - $50.00
|
|
|
|Share Based Compensation Shares Authorized Under Stock Option Plans Exercise Price Range [Line Items]
|
|
|
|Range of Exercise Prices, lower limit
|$ 40.01us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eLowerRangeLimit
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= esl_RangeTwoMember
|
|
|Range of Exercise Prices, upper limit
|$ 50.00us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eUpperRangeLimit
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= esl_RangeTwoMember
|
|
|Options Outstanding, Shares
|196,675us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eNumberOfOutstandingOptions
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= esl_RangeTwoMember
|
|
|Options Outstanding Weighted Average Remaining Life (years)
|4 years 6 months
|
|
|Options Outstanding, Weighted Average Price
|$ 41.71us-gaap_Sharebas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eOutstandingOptionsWeightedAverageExercisePriceBeginningBalance1
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= esl_RangeTwoMember
|
|
|Options Exercisable, Shares
|196,675us-gaap_ShareBasedCompensationArrangementByShareBasedPaymentAwardOptionsExercisableNumber
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= esl_RangeTwoMember
|
|
|Options Exercisable, Weighted Average Price
|$ 41.71us-gaap_Sharebas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eExercisableOptionsWeightedAverageExercisePrice1
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= esl_RangeTwoMember
|
|
|$50.01 - $52.00
|
|
|
|Share Based Compensation Shares Authorized Under Stock Option Plans Exercise Price Range [Line Items]
|
|
|
|Range of Exercise Prices, lower limit
|$ 50.01us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eLowerRangeLimit
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= esl_RangeThreeMember
|
|
|Range of Exercise Prices, upper limit
|$ 52.00us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eUpperRangeLimit
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= esl_RangeThreeMember
|
|
|Options Outstanding, Shares
|242,000us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eNumberOfOutstandingOptions
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= esl_RangeThreeMember
|
|
|Options Outstanding Weighted Average Remaining Life (years)
|6 years 6 months
|
|
|Options Outstanding, Weighted Average Price
|$ 51.06us-gaap_Sharebas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eOutstandingOptionsWeightedAverageExercisePriceBeginningBalance1
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= esl_RangeThreeMember
|
|
|Options Exercisable, Shares
|109,600us-gaap_ShareBasedCompensationArrangementByShareBasedPaymentAwardOptionsExercisableNumber
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= esl_RangeThreeMember
|
|
|Options Exercisable, Weighted Average Price
|$ 51.05us-gaap_Sharebas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eExercisableOptionsWeightedAverageExercisePrice1
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= esl_RangeThreeMember
|
|
|$52.01 - $65.00
|
|
|
|Share Based Compensation Shares Authorized Under Stock Option Plans Exercise Price Range [Line Items]
|
|
|
|Range of Exercise Prices, lower limit
|$ 52.01us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eLowerRangeLimit
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= esl_RangeFourMember
|
|
|Range of Exercise Prices, upper limit
|$ 65.00us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eUpperRangeLimit
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= esl_RangeFourMember
|
|
|Options Outstanding, Shares
|426,850us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eNumberOfOutstandingOptions
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= esl_RangeFourMember
|
|
|Options Outstanding Weighted Average Remaining Life (years)
|5 years 4 months 24 days
|
|
|Options Outstanding, Weighted Average Price
|$ 59.75us-gaap_Sharebas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eOutstandingOptionsWeightedAverageExercisePriceBeginningBalance1
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= esl_RangeFourMember
|
|
|Options Exercisable, Shares
|278,550us-gaap_ShareBasedCompensationArrangementByShareBasedPaymentAwardOptionsExercisableNumber
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= esl_RangeFourMember
|
|
|Options Exercisable, Weighted Average Price
|$ 59.16us-gaap_Sharebas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eExercisableOptionsWeightedAverageExercisePrice1
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= esl_RangeFourMember
|
|
|$65.01 - $80.00
|
|
|
|Share Based Compensation Shares Authorized Under Stock Option Plans Exercise Price Range [Line Items]
|
|
|
|Range of Exercise Prices, lower limit
|$ 65.01us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eLowerRangeLimit
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= esl_RangeFiveMember
|
|
|Range of Exercise Prices, upper limit
|$ 80.00us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eUpperRangeLimit
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= esl_RangeFiveMember
|
|
|Options Outstanding, Shares
|182,475us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eNumberOfOutstandingOptions
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= esl_RangeFiveMember
|
|
|Options Outstanding Weighted Average Remaining Life (years)
|7 years 9 months 18 days
|
|
|Options Outstanding, Weighted Average Price
|$ 69.10us-gaap_Sharebas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eOutstandingOptionsWeightedAverageExercisePriceBeginningBalance1
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= esl_RangeFiveMember
|
|
|Options Exercisable, Shares
|48,950us-gaap_ShareBasedCompensationArrangementByShareBasedPaymentAwardOptionsExercisableNumber
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= esl_RangeFiveMember
|
|
|Options Exercisable, Weighted Average Price
|$ 71.79us-gaap_Sharebas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eExercisableOptionsWeightedAverageExercisePrice1
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= esl_RangeFiveMember
|
|
|$80.01 - $118.32
|
|
|
|Share Based Compensation Shares Authorized Under Stock Option Plans Exercise Price Range [Line Items]
|
|
|
|Range of Exercise Prices, lower limit
|$ 80.01us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eLowerRangeLimit
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= esl_RangeSixMember
|
|
|Range of Exercise Prices, upper limit
|$ 118.32us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eUpperRangeLimit
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= esl_RangeSixMember
|
|
|Options Outstanding, Shares
|210,700us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eNumberOfOutstandingOptions
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= esl_RangeSixMember
|
|
|Options Outstanding Weighted Average Remaining Life (years)
|9 years 2 months 12 days
|
|
|Options Outstanding, Weighted Average Price
|$ 96.63us-gaap_Sharebas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eOutstandingOptionsWeightedAverageExercisePriceBeginningBalance1
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= esl_RangeSixMember
|
|
|Options Exercisable, Shares
|2,575us-gaap_ShareBasedCompensationArrangementByShareBasedPaymentAwardOptionsExercisableNumber
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= esl_RangeSixMember
|
|
|Options Exercisable, Weighted Average Price
|$ 81.76us-gaap_SharebasedCompensationSharesAuthorizedUnderStockOptionPlansExercisePriceRangeExercisableOptionsWeightedAverageExercisePrice1
/ us-gaap_ShareBasedCompensationSharesAuthorizedUnderStockOptionPlansByExercisePriceRangeAxis
= esl_RangeSixMember
|
|